Wagering requirements, often expressed as a multiplier (e.g., 35x), define how many times you must play through the bonus amount before withdrawing any winnings. A common error is assuming that a $100 bonus with a 30x requirement means you only need to wager $100. In reality, you need to bet $3,000 before you can cash out. This misunderstanding leads to players believing they have won money when they are still far from meeting the conditions.
To avoid this, always calculate the total wagering amount before committing. Use a simple formula: bonus amount multiplied by the wagering requirement. If the requirement includes both the deposit and bonus, factor that in as well. Being aware of these numbers helps you choose bonuses that align with your bankroll and playing style, rather than chasing offers that are nearly impossible to clear.
Account verification is a standard procedure for online casinos to comply with anti-money laundering regulations and ensure player security. Many new players delay uploading their identification documents, assuming they can do it later. However, this often backfires at the first withdrawal request. The casino will freeze the transaction until verification is complete, which can take days or even weeks if documents are rejected.
Complete the verification process immediately after registering. Provide a clear copy of your government-issued ID, proof of address (such as a utility bill), and any other requested documents. This proactive step ensures that when you win, your funds are released without unnecessary delays. It also protects you from potential fraud by confirming your identity early.

Not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ements. Slots typically count 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ette may contribute only 10% or even 0%. A player who spins slots for two hours might see their wagering progress quickly, but someone playing baccarat will barely move the meter. This discrepancy is often hidden in the bonus terms and catches many off guard.
Before starting, locate the game contribution table in the terms or contact support. Focus your play on games with high contribution percentages, such as slots, unless you specifically enjoy low-contribution games. If you prefer table games, consider whether the bonus is worth claiming given the slower progress. This awareness ensures you don’t waste time on games that don’t help you meet requirements.

Emotional betting is a dangerous habit that often follows a losing streak. The urge to win back lost money can lead to reckless decisions, such as increasing bet sizes or playing games with poor odds. This behavior rarely ends well, as losses typically accelerate. Without a predetermined budget, players may spend more than they can afford, leading to financial stress.
Set a strict gambling budget before you start playing. Decide on a maximum amount you are willing to lose and stick to it, regardless of outcomes. Use features like deposit limits offered by the casino to enforce this boundary. Remember that gambling should be entertainment, not a way to make money. Accepting losses as part of the experience helps maintain control and prevents chasing behavior.
